Serie Maestría en Programación Dinámica DP — Roadmap. Una guía práctica y directa para dominar los patrones fundamentales de DP que necesitan ingenieros de software, científicos de datos y equipos de producto. En Q2BSTUDIO, empresa de desarrollo de software a medida y aplicaciones a medida, usamos estos patrones para crear soluciones de alto rendimiento en inteligencia artificial, agentes IA, servicios inteligencia de negocio y optimización a gran escala. Integramos DP con servicios cloud aws y azure, ciberseguridad y arquitecturas modernas para acelerar la entrega de valor en ia para empresas.
[Blog 1: Fundamentos de DP y definición de estado]
- Relaciones de recurrencia, subproblemas superpuestos, memoización vs tabulación. - Cómo definir el estado dp[i][j] y qué representa cada dimensión. - Casos base y transiciones claras. - Ejemplos clásicos: Fibonacci y Escaleras Climbing Stairs.
[Blog 2: DP 1D Problemas lineales]
- Ladrón de casas House Robber. - Subarray máximo algoritmo de Kadane. - Variantes de Jump Game. - Coste mínimo o máximo en trayectorias lineales.
[Blog 3: DP en cuadrículas 2D Problemas de matriz]
- Caminos únicos Unique Paths. - Suma mínima de camino Minimum Path Sum. - Recolección en rejilla Cherry Pickup y problemas de doble recorrido. - Navegación con obstáculos Obstacle Grid.
[Blog 4: Patrón Knapsack Subconjuntos y partición]
- Mochila 0 1. - Suma de subconjuntos Subset Sum. - Partición en subconjuntos de suma igual. - Target Sum y variaciones.
[Blog 5: DP en cadenas Subsecuencias y subcadenas]
- LCS Longest Common Subsequence. - Longest Palindromic Subsequence. - Distancia de edición Edit Distance. - Emparejamiento de expresiones regulares Regular Expression Matching.
[Blog 6: DP en subsecuencias Patrones en arrays y strings]
- LIS Longest Increasing Subsequence. - Russian Doll Envelopes. - Longitud máxima de cadena de pares. - Conteo de subsecuencias crecientes.
[Blog 7: DP en intervalos]
- Multiplicación de cadenas de matrices Matrix Chain Multiplication. - Burst Balloons. - Particionamiento palindrómico. - Árbol de búsqueda binaria óptimo Optimal BST.
[Blog 8: DP en árboles y grafos]
- Diámetro de un árbol DP sobre árboles. - House Robber III versión en árbol. - DP con DFS para rutas en DAGs. - Coloreo de árboles y conjunto independiente.
[Blog 9: DP con bitmasking Avanzado]
- Problema del viajante TSP con bitmask DP. - Mínimo número de incompatibilidades. - Conteo de caminos hamiltonianos. - Particiones con bitmask.
[Blog 10: Técnicas de optimización de DP]
- Optimización de espacio con arrays rodantes. - Divide and Conquer DP. - Convex Hull Trick para transiciones lineales. - Optimización de Knuth. - DP con cola monótona Monotonic Queue.
Al finalizar esta serie, dominarás patrones y técnicas que te harán a prueba de entrevistas y listo para diseño de sistemas, especialmente en problemas de optimización donde la DP suele jugar un papel oculto en motores de recomendación, planificación, pricing, ruteo, series temporales e inteligencia artificial aplicada.
Cómo lo llevamos a producción en Q2BSTUDIO
- Construimos software a medida y aplicaciones a medida integrando DP en microservicios escalables, APIs y pipelines de datos. - Aplicamos estos patrones en soluciones de inteligencia artificial y agentes IA para inferencia rápida, aprendizaje por refuerzo y optimización combinatoria. - Desplegamos en servicios cloud aws y azure con observabilidad y ciberseguridad de extremo a extremo, y conectamos resultados con servicios inteligencia de negocio y power bi para analítica accionable.
Si quieres aplicar estos patrones en productos reales con un equipo experto, descubre cómo usamos IA de vanguardia en inteligencia artificial e ia para empresas. Y si necesitas una plataforma robusta lista para crecer, te acompañamos con software a medida y aplicaciones a medida que convierten algoritmos en impacto de negocio.
Palabras clave relacionadas para ayudarte a encontrar lo que necesitas con nosotros: software a medida, aplicaciones a medida, inteligencia artificial, ciberseguridad, servicios cloud aws y azure, servicios inteligencia de negocio, ia para empresas, agentes IA y power bi.